#6a1226 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6a1226 is composed of 41.6% red, 7.1%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83% magenta, 64.2%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 346.4 degrees, a saturation of 71% and a lightness of 24.3%. #6a1226 color hex could be obtained by blending #d4244c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#6a1226 color description : Very dark red.

#6a1226 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6a1226 has RGB values of R:106, G:18, B:38 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.64,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 6951462.

Shades and Tints of #6a1226

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050102 is the darkest color, while #fdf4f6 is the lightest one.
